Output 14cf66f32dfbf8b3ee16847296367c30a87d513f852c367ab0e3f200a5e9a897:7

value
195308844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243debadbc33ef1568c70e58985bad2b8310aa3d OP_EQUAL
address
MBCnjf1bmQihbs2Q9Y8R3advFGqvJQPJbZ
transaction
14cf66f32dfbf8b3ee16847296367c30a87d513f852c367ab0e3f200a5e9a897
spent
true